Nintendo shared a bunch of new information during its 82nd Annual General Meeting of Shareholders, and that included a breakdown of what some of the company’s top directors make. In particular, we now know what Shuntaro Furukawa, Shigeru Miyamoto, and Shinya Takahashi are pulling in each year.

While we’ve always heard Nintendo’s higher-ups have rather modest earnings when compared to some of the big-name execs out there, they’re still making a pretty substantial amount of money. Here’s what the trio pulled in during the last fiscal year.

  • Shuntaro Furukawa: $2.3 million
  • Shigeru Miyamoto: $1.8 million
  • Shinya Takahashi: $1.4 million
